Speaking with the NYT in October, Snowden said he did not take any classified documents with him when he ended up in Russia in June.

"There's a zero percent chance the Russians or Chinese have received any documents," Snowden told the paper.

Snowden, who is currently living in an undisclosed location in Russia after receiving temporary asylum, reportedly requested protection from Russian law enforcement after a series of death threats were aired against him in the US media.

"We are concerned with the situation around Edward," Kucherena said on Tuesday. "We see the statements made by some US officials containing potential and implicit threats and openly calling for causing him bodily harm."
